MRD8 |
Just snatched this radio broadcast from DIME:
White stripes
O2 Wireless festival, London, UK
2007-06-14
1 - Dead Leaves And The Dirty Ground / When I Hear My Name
2 - Hotel Yorba
3 - Icky Thump
4 - I'm Slowly Turning Into You
5 - I Think I Smell A Rat
6 - I'm A Martyr For My Love For You
7 - Death Letter / Motherless Children
8 - In The Cold Cold Night
9 - Jolene
10 - Cannon / John The Revelator / Astro / Ball & Biscuit
11 - Blue Orchid
12 - The Denial Twist / Wasting My Time
13 - I Just Dont Know What To Do With Myself
14 - We're Going To Be Friends
15 - Seven Nation Army
